Output 8dfa5e84bc7a18901623c76cf12f4ea6cb4af7f7c63a9aa0b63272eaad2b0606:3

value
670084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296cf9fa93f5fb195acc9c2e6d0a84833cb37807 OP_EQUAL
address
35U4BE95wuwox3GhgGE3gf3qqCLfKQik6X
transaction
8dfa5e84bc7a18901623c76cf12f4ea6cb4af7f7c63a9aa0b63272eaad2b0606